Basic testing principles of magnetic particle inspection

When a ferromagnetic workpiece is placed in a magnetic field, magnetic field lines are directed toward and through the workpiece. If the magnetic field lines act on the crack, the magnetic field lines will not be continuous and will overflow the surface of the workpiece, thus producing magnetic poles on both sides of the crack. Spray magnetic powder (or magnetic suspension) on the surface of the defective workpiece, and the magnetic powder will form an obviously visible line at the crack (Figure 1). The color of the magnetic powder should be chosen to have a greater contrast with the surface of the workpiece as much as possible, which will make it easier for defects to be observed by the human eye (this equipment uses fluorescent magnetic powder). This is the basic testing principle of magnetic particle testing.

Product Name CEW-8000 AC and DC half-wave fluorescent magnetic particle flaw detection machine
Main technical parameters:
  1. Power supply: three-phase five-wire 50Hz 380V±10% 160KVA (maximum instantaneous);
  2. Magnetization method: circumferential, longitudinal, composite magnetization;
  3. Circumferential magnetizing current: AC: 0-8000A, continuously adjustable; with power-off phase control function. DC: 0~4000A half-wave average, continuously adjustable;
  4. Longitudinal magnetizing current: AC: 0-16000AT, continuously adjustable; with power-off phase control function DC: 0-8000AT, continuously adjustable; with power-off phase control function
  5. Coil inner diameter: Φ350mm
  6. Detectable workpiece length: 4000mm;
  7. Detectable workpiece diameter: ≦250mm;
  8. Sensitivity: Magnetized according to the process specification JB/6965-92 "Standard Test Pieces for Magnetic Particle Flaw Detection Machines", the full circle and cross of type A sensitivity test piece 2# (15/50) can be clearly displayed;
  9. Current duty cycle: not less than 25% at full load;
  10. Magnetic field intensity on workpiece surface: ≥2400A/m;
  11. Workpiece clamping rotation mode: electric;
  12. Tail electrode movement mode: electric;
  13. Electrode clamping method: pneumatic;
  14. Working mode: manual and automatic;
  15. Loading and unloading methods: manual;
  16. Air source pressure: 0.4-0.6Mpa;
  17. Demagnetization method: circumferential and longitudinal automatic attenuation demagnetization, which is convenient and fast;
  18. Demagnetization effect: residual magnetism ≤ 0.2mT (3Oe);
  19. Ultraviolet illumination: ≥4500uw/cm2 at a distance of 380mm from the light source;
